Tuna Rice Bowl (Easy Mediterranean Recipe in 20 Minutes)

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es
Servings 2 servings
Calories 450
A quick and flavorful Mediterranean-inspired tuna rice bowl perfect for a healthy lunch or dinner in just 20 minutes.

Ingredients

Rice

  • 2 cups cooked rice (at room temperature)

Tuna

  • 2 cans tuna (approx. 5 oz each, drained)

Dairy & Condiments

  • cup Greek yogurt
  • 1 tablespoon tahini (or mayonnaise)

Fruits & Vegetables

  • ½ lemon lemon (zest and juice)
  • 2 tablespoons parsley (plus 1 tsp dried oregano (optional))
  • 1 small clove garlic (grated)
  • 1.5 cups fresh vegetables
  • ½ cup jarred vegetables (olives, roasted peppers, sun-dried tomatoes, artichoke hearts)
  • 1 pinch optional toppings (sesame seeds, pickled onions, toasted nuts, za'atar)

Instructions 

  • Mix cooked rice with salt, oregano, and lemon zest; drizzle with olive oil if desired. Divide into bowls.
  • In a bowl, mash tuna with yogurt, tahini, lemon juice, parsley, and garlic until creamy.
  • Arrange fresh and jarred vegetables around rice, then top with tuna mixture. Garnish with seeds, za'atar, or crunchy toppings.

Notes

Feel free to customize toppings and vegetables for variety.
